NOVELTY - Preparation of sodium ion battery titanium dioxide/graphene composite negative electrode material comprises mixing 20-100 mg graphene and 30-300 mL deionized water, ultrasonic treating for 30-180 minutes, adding 0.1-2.5 g titanium tetrachloride, stirring, ultrasonic treating for 30-120 minutes, feeding to hydrothermal synthesis reactor, reacting at 120-260 degrees C for 3-40 hours, quenching to room temperature, centrifuging, and freeze-drying. USE - Method for preparing sodium ion battery titanium dioxide/graphene composite negative electrode material. ADVANTAGE - The material has good cycle life, high electric conductivity, and improved physical and chemical stability and electrochemical performance. The preparation method is low cost and suitable for industrial production.
